comp.lang.ada
 help / color / mirror / Atom feed
From: CONDIC@PSAVAX.PWFL.COM
Subject: Re: Let's cover this one more time...
Date: Fri, 18 Nov 1994 12:14:18 EST
Date: 1994-11-18T12:14:18-05:00	[thread overview]
Message-ID: <9411181718.AA27699@ajpo.sei.cmu.edu> (raw)

From: Marin David Condic, 407.796.8997, M/S 731-93
Subject: Re: Let's cover this one more time...
Original_To:  PROFS%"SMTP@PWAGPDB"
Original_cc:  CONDIC



Nick Sizemore <sizemore@HUACHUCA-EMH17.ARMY.MIL> writes:
>         Is there some reason, either in priciple or in practice, why such
>    tools (as opposed to the line by line 'converters') are out of the
>    question for the project described?  I do know of at least one company
>    locally which used the McCabe tools to re-engineer an Ada system
>    (i.e., no conversion) and was pleased with the results.  Just asking -
>    I have no vested interest.
>
It's more of a personal bias - I don't believe that an automated
translation of "legacy" code from *any* language to *any other*
language is ever going to be done well. By this, I mean you will
end up with code that is not very intelligible or will use obscure
language constructs to insure correct translation and in general
will be more difficult to work with than the original system.
(Ever wonder why people generally don't want to mess with the
assembler output of a compiler?)

Throw on top of it that we are talking about a fairly old and
really large body of FORTRAN code to be translated. Sight unseen,
most of us would out-of-hand admit that we can do a better job of
"engineering" a system today than was originally done back in the
mid-70's. Sight seen - I can asure you this is the case.

I'd prefer to make the case that it would be more cost effective
(say, over five years) to reengineer the system from the ground
up than it would be to auto-translate it and spend forever
patching the code until it works.

Pax,
Marin


Marin David Condic, Senior Computer Engineer    ATT:        407.796.8997
M/S 731-93                                      Technet:    796.8997
Pratt & Whitney, GESP                           Internet:   CONDICMA@PWFL.COM
P.O. Box 109600                                 Internet:   MDCONDIC@AOL.COM
West Palm Beach, FL 33410-9600
===============================================================================
    "Paranoia is just a kind of awareness, and awareness is just a
    form of love."

        --  Charles Manson
===============================================================================



             reply	other threads:[~1994-11-18 17:14 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
1994-11-18 17:14 CONDIC [this message]
1994-11-21 14:32 ` Let's cover this one more time Michael J. Meier
  -- strict thread matches above, loose matches on Subject: below --
1994-11-17 19:08 Nick Sizemore
1994-11-18 16:10 ` Charles Stump
1994-11-16 20:35 CONDIC
replies disabled

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ox